Saratou Traoré is a 23-year-old football player who plays as a midfielder, born on 27. syyskuuta 2002. Follow Saratou Traoré on FotMob for live match updates, detailed statistics, career history, transfer news, FotMob ratings, and comprehensive performance analytics.

Saratou Traoré scores highly on Goals, Assists, and Minutes compared to midfielders in the their league.

Saratou Traoré's 4 most recent matches are shown below. Visit each match page for full details including lineups, match events, and advanced statistics:

  • 18. heinäkuuta 2025: 1-3 loss away at Morocco (90 minutes)
  • 14. heinäkuuta 2025: 0-4 loss away at South Africa (90 minutes)
  • 11. heinäkuuta 2025: 1-1 draw away at Ghana (90 minutes, 1 assist)
  • 7. heinäkuuta 2025: 1-0 win at home vs Tanzania (90 minutes, 1 goal)

Saratou Traoré's career has also included time at Wuhan Jiangda Women’s FC and Guingamp.

On the international stage, Saratou Traoré has represented Mali.
